Empanelment and Disciplinary Committee (EDC)
An Empanelment and Disciplinary Committee (EDC) of RAHCT will regulate the NWH services.
Empanelment and Disciplinary Committee (EDC) under the chairmanship of Chief Medical Auditor of the Rajiv Aarogyasri Health Care Trust is responsible for empanelment of new hospitals.
EDC ensures that a hospital possesses adequate infrastructure, man power, equipment requirements of the Rajiv Aarogyasri Health Care Trust, and conforms to the service and quality standards of various health schemes being implemented by Trust.
The empanelment process followed by the Rajiv Aarogyasri Health Care Trust includes online procedures,Disciplinary actions, and settlement of disputes regarding claims.
Medical Audit
The success of the scheme rests on ensuring that all the stakeholders adhere to the highest level of medical ethics. Chief Medical Auditor shall be performing the following medical audit functions:
- Monitoring of quality of medical care.
- Framing guidelines to prevent moral hazard.
- Monitoring the trends of utilization of listed therapies across NWHs.
- Conduct investigation into allegations of treatment lapses.
- Analyze mortality and morbidity under this scheme and recommend corrective measures
- Recommend punitive actions against a medical professional or NWH.
NWH Obligations
Reception:
NWH shall place kiosk at the reception or at the patient entry point to the NWH as decided by the Rajiv Aarogyasri Health Care Trust for the purpose of reception and registration. It shall provide 2 MBPS net connection and dedicated computer with peripherals. NWH shall identify, direct and register all the patients holding eligibility card.
Free pre-evaluation
- All the beneficiaries shall be pre-evaluated for the listed therapies till the diagnosis is established.
- Counseling for packages where facilities are unavailable.
- The patient shall be properly counselled and referred to nearby NWH for further management, if found to be suffering from diseases other than those that cannot be managed in the NWH.
